Domestic Violence is never Kind..although it may say kind things it is never backed up in loyalty , trust or dependence...what is usually promised to the partner of domestic violence is usually not delivered..although at the time the person afflicting it may really believe that themselves, but when the time comes the partners, feelings, aspirations are usually forgotten..

The domestic violent person actually feels sorry at the time of certain incidents they do not hold that sorrow for long..as you see in situations where after abusing the partner, grave sorrow is announced by the person to the partner.. example..it will never happen again, profess their life, their fears of life without the partner..their total devoted love for that part, what that person thinks is Love and Kindness is the way the violent partner moves on from the situation without dealing with their own feelings..

Do you profess Your Love one hour and the next yell because something you considered important is not done...
Do you say , Yes I understand to Your partner when You really dont feel its that important.
Do You make plans and cancel for others things that you would like to do which seem more of a priority.
Do You say unkind words about your partner to others and blame them for all the problems,trial and disappointments in the relationship.
Do You say You will stand by them, only to not be available when they really need you ,while you do things You feel are more important.
Are you rude or call the person stupid, winy, or trivialize what they do or say.
Are You actually thinking of other things when Your partner is involved in conversation with you.


As You see domestic violence covers a wide range of emotions, and the partner who is subjected to these can become , withdrawn, not feel like an individual , depressed and can shut down all feelings and copes by depending  on the domestic violent partner instead of there own individuality..
